About the Role:
As Artworker, you will prepare, adapt and check production-ready artwork for point-of-sale, retail-display, packaging and printed projects, turning approved creative concepts and client-supplied files into accurate technical artwork that meets brand, material, print, finishing and manufacturing requirements before release to production.
Key responsibilities include:
- Creating, adapting and amending artwork for point-of-sale, retail-display, packaging and printed applications in line with approved briefs, across multiple formats, sizes and substrates.
- Applying cutter guides, keylines, bleeds, safe areas, folds, joins, panels and other technical production requirements correctly.
- Maintaining consistency across campaign variants, language versions, store formats and related artwork suites, following client brand guidelines precisely.
- Retouching, resizing and optimising images while maintaining appropriate resolution and quality.
- Preflighting all artwork before proofing or release, checking dimensions, scale, resolution, colour space, fonts, links, overprints, trapping and transparency.
- Preparing and issuing accurate proofs for internal and client approval, and completing final quality checks before releasing files to Production or external suppliers.
- Managing assigned artwork jobs through the studio workflow, prioritising tasks in line with production schedules and agreed deadlines.
- Liaising with Client Services, Design, Planning, Estimating and Production to confirm specifications and resolve technical queries.
- Supporting Production with artwork-related questions, first-offs and amendments, and escalating unresolved or high-risk issues to the reporting manager.
- Contributing to artwork reviews, first-off checks and continuous-improvement activity across the studio and production teams.
